site stats

Ctpl thread pool

WebThe constructor of boost::scoped_thread expects an object of type boost::thread.In the destructor of boost::scoped_thread an action has access to that object. By default, boost::scoped_thread uses an action that calls join() on the thread. Thus, Example 44.2 works like Example 44.1. You can pass a user-defined action as a template parameter. … WebJan 5, 1997 · Pastebin.com is the number one paste tool since 2002. Pastebin is a website where you can store text online for a set period of time.

Recommendations for thread pool library : r/cpp - reddit

WebA t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. WebOct 13, 2024 · A thread pool is a technique that allows developers to exploit the concurrency of modern processors in an easy and efficient manner. It's easy because you send "work" to the pool and somehow this work gets done without blocking the main thread. It's efficient because threads are not initialized each time we want the work to be done. frenchs mort https://qandatraders.com

CTPL Thread pool library how to wait for all threads to …

WebNov 2, 2024 · Dash Core: ctpl::thread_pool Class Reference Dash Core Source Documentation (0.16.0.1) CPubKey crash_info crash_info_header CRateCheckBuffer … Web您应该使用 thread pool . 具体来说,您可以使用C ++线程池库 cptl ,您的代码将与之使用看起来像这样: ctpl::thread_pool p(2 /* two threads in the pool */); for (int i = 0; i < 100; i++) { p.push(someJob, "additional_param"); } 其他推荐答案. 您可以简单地使用std::async. WebNov 2, 2024 · std::vector > ctpl::thread_pool::threads. private. Definition at line 226 of file ctpl.h. Referenced by get_thread (), resize (), set_thread (), … fast right issue

CTPL Modern and efficient C Thread Pool Library

Category:C++11/14 Thread Pool Library : cpp_questions - Reddit

Tags:Ctpl thread pool

Ctpl thread pool

quicksort_threads/quicksort_threads.cpp at master · peter …

WebApr 24, 2024 · CTPL - A no-frills single-header-only library; has two variants: one only relying on the standard library, the other using a lock-free queue implementation from … WebPool League Software. Run Your Own League With Us! Visit Today To Get Started. 625,311 league games??? Looking for ??? Click Here! Since 2004. Admin : Leagues: …

Ctpl thread pool

Did you know?

WebModern and efficient C++ Thread Pool Library. Contribute to vit-vit/CTPL development by creating an account on GitHub.

WebIn computer programming, a thread pool is a software design pattern for achieving concurrency of execution in a computer program. Often also called a replicated workers … WebJan 5, 2024 · 5 years ago C++11/14 Thread Pool Library OPEN Seeking suggestions for good ready-to-use modern C++ thread-pool libraries? Hopefully something that is …

WebFeb 20, 2024 · A few days ago, I got a crash on C3M3_B, and Tormentor667 reported a similar crash with C1M4 today. I'll edit this post with more details, such as GZDoom version, WolfenDoom commit, and the crash log if it happens to me again. UPDATE: GZDoom version: 4.3.3 (release) WolfenDoom commit: 7b965529. Savegame file. WebJun 14, 2024 · I use CTPL library for thread pools. I know that writing from a thread into an array cell passed by reference is not a data race (please correct me if i'm wrong) so i decided to pass a cell from the array to the function so i can write multiplication result into the cell itself, not by passing the reference to an array and the index, so i can ...

WebThreadpool in C++ is basically a pool having a fixed number of threads used when we want to work multiple tasks together (run multiple threads concurrently). This thread sits idle in the thread pool when there are no …

WebSep 26, 2014 · ThreadPool A simple C++11 Thread Pool implementation. Basic usage: // create thread pool with 4 worker threads ThreadPool pool ( 4 ); // enqueue and store … fastrip 150WebMar 17, 2024 · * Threads Id Target Id Frame * 1 Thread 0x7fdf03463840 (LWP 23442) "gzdoom" 0x00007fdf03803097 in wait4 from /usr/lib/libc.so.6 2 Thread 0x7fdf034606c0 (LWP 23443) "gzdoom" 0x00007fdf037b44b6 in ?? fast right click minecraftWebAug 2, 2024 · pool.get_thread(i).join() is not the solution; it freezes the because the thread is running always running to accept new commands, which is its intended behavior. The … fast right wingers fifa 21WebFeb 28, 2024 · Possible Solutions The best solution - just to fix the architecture, because threads within static objects - isn't the best approach. Another option - to use boost instead of STL c++ multithreading synchronization condition-variable Share Improve this question Follow edited Nov 24, 2024 at 21:04 asked Feb 28, 2024 at 13:03 Serhii Pavlenko 121 1 6 french smugglersWebJun 11, 2015 · CTPL. Modern and efficient C++ Thread Pool Library. A thread pool is a programming pattern for parallel execution of jobs, … fas tri-nations seriesWebAug 3, 2024 · The library presented here contains a thread pool class, BS::thread_pool, which avoids these issues by creating a fixed pool of threads once and for all, and then continuously reusing the same … fast right or cheapWebAug 24, 2024 · ctpl::thread_pool p (num_of_threads); results = p.push (grep_func (cwd.string (), search, def_log_name, def_txt_name)); ./grepx "word" -d [directory_name] -l [log_file] -r [result_file] [-t] [threads] ```4 I ---I this is how I execute the function. c++ linux threadpool Share Improve this question Follow edited Aug 24, 2024 at 16:53 Victor Gubin fas tri nations